Special Warning is a curious piece. It plays with themes of isolation and guilt, wrapped in a surreal atmosphere that feels more like an art installation than a traditional film. The pacing can be slow, which might throw off some viewers, but it builds this haunting sense of dread that lingers. The use of horns adds an odd twist, contrasting with the darker themes—almost like a humorous undertone amidst the heaviness. Its unconventional narrative style and the way it embraces the absurd make it distinctive. It’s like watching a twisted poem unfold rather than a typical story.
Special Warning hasn't seen a lot of re-releases, which makes it a bit scarce. The home video formats are limited, and while it may not have a massive following, those who do appreciate it often speak of its distinctive style and thematic depth. Collector interest is moderate, leaning more toward niche enthusiasts who enjoy exploring offbeat cinema.
